What is Pesticide Notification

The California Pesticide Notification Form is a permission slip used by parents or guardians to request prior notification of pesticide applications at their child's school.

Purpose and Importance of the California Pesticide Notification Form

This form benefits parents and guardians by providing essential information about when and where pesticides will be applied in school settings. Keeping parents informed helps them manage their children's exposure to these chemicals. The implications of the Healthy Schools Act of 2000 further reinforce this necessity, requiring schools to notify families about any pesticide applications.
Utilizing the pesticide notification form allows parents to feel more secure about their children's safety, aligning with the legislative support intended to protect children in educational environments.
